10 Essential Tips for Passing Your Driving Test: A Sure-Drive Driver’s Training Guide

Passing your driving test is an exciting milestone on the journey to becoming a licensed driver. However, the test itself can be nerve-wracking for many aspiring drivers.   1. Study the Driving Handbook
    Familiarize yourself with the rules of the road by studying the driving handbook provided by your state’s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). Understand traffic signs, signals, and the various laws that govern driving.
  2. Practice, Practice, Practice
    Practice is key to gaining confidence behind the wheel. Make sure to clock in plenty of practice hours with a licensed driver or a professional instructor. Focus on different driving scenarios, such as residential areas, highways, and parking lots.
  3. Know Your Vehicle
    Become familiar with the vehicle you will use for your driving test. Adjust the mirrors, seat, and steering wheel to your comfort and learn the basic functions of the car, such as lights, wipers, and turn signals.
  4. Master Basic Maneuvers
    Practice essential maneuvers such as parallel parking, three-point turns, and backing up in a straight line. These skills are often tested during the driving test, and mastering them will boost your confidence.
  5. Observe Proper Safety Measures
    During your driving test, prioritize safety above all else. Always wear your seatbelt, check your mirrors frequently, use your turn signals appropriately, and obey traffic laws.
  6. Stay Calm and Focused
    Nervousness is normal during a driving test, but it’s important to stay calm and focused. Take deep breaths, trust in your preparation, and concentrate on the task at hand. Avoid letting anxiety or distractions affect your performance.
  7. Follow Instructions Carefully
    Listen attentively to your examiner’s instructions and follow them precisely. Clarify any doubts before starting a task, and if you’re unsure about something, don’t hesitate to ask for clarification.
  8. Practice Hazard Perception
    Develop your hazard perception skills by identifying potential risks on the road. Learn to anticipate the actions of other drivers, pedestrians, and cyclists, and respond appropriately.
  9. Review Common Mistakes
    Reflect on any mistakes you’ve made during practice sessions and previous driving experiences. Identify areas where you can improve, such as signaling, lane changes, or speed control, and focus on refining those skills.
  10. Be Confident and Positive
    Believe in yourself and approach the driving test with a positive mindset. Visualize success and maintain a confident demeanor throughout the test. Remember, the examiner wants you to succeed and will be assessing your ability to drive safely.
